I think Ricoh (or any company) has a certain amount of money and time that can be spent on R&D. They consistently make cameras that outperform Sony and Nikon (which often use the same sensor). And it's hard to argue they aren't physically better designs than Sony, and probably Nikon as well. I've shot with Nikon as a second system, and I personally preferred my Pentax bodies to my Nikon bodies, especially the Green button and hyper manual mode.

I'd personally rather they continue to pour their budget of time and money into the UX/UI and imaging pipeline than give us novelty features. Frankly, if they have the UX/UI and still imaging solved then the next step is video (which I personally don't care about but is the next logical step) before gimmick features like the Kodak Easy Share base for charging and image transfer (Kodak died despite this amazing concept).

Wireless charging and Wi-Fi don't necessarily make the process of creating a great photograph any easier. Whereas flippy screens, pixel shift and shake reduction all can be used directly in the process of photographic creativity.

I guess I'm in the minority but I really don't care much about the tech aspect. I do like built in GPS for geotagging on the K-1. I like the Wi-Fi for pulling a few images off to upload to social media on the fly. But for the most part, removing batteries and memory cards and all that really doesn't bother me. I grew up shooting film and dumping a memory card and recharging a couple of batteries is just part of the digital process.

If people want to do photography on there phones, more power to them. You've got a very powerful and useful device that fits in your pocket and has always on connectivity. Personally, I enjoy getting away from my phone and enjoy the chance to enjoy some down time from always being connected.
